Our approach is like a birds nest. Birds can come, relax, spend their time here. The nest is the organisation, and the birds are all the community members we are working with. It is a shared nest, they can come and feel safe and comfortable. The nest is made of such tightly interwoven materials, so it becomes very strong and protective. It also represents how the organisation looks very simple, it is made of simple materials, but it is interwoven so tightly so it doesn’t dismantle easily.

This object is part of the Metaphors for Un/Making CSC Collection.

Created in Mysuru, India, 2023
